Slackware update for INN
Secunia Advisory: SA10632
Release Date: 2004-01-15
Popularity: 6,821 views

Critical:
Highly critical
Impact: System access
Where: From remote
Solution Status: Vendor Patch

OS:Slackware Linux 9.0
Slackware Linux 9.1

Subscribe: Instant alerts on relevant vulnerabilities


Description:
Slackware has issued updated packages for INN. These fix a vulnerability, which can be exploited by malicious people to gain system access.

For more information:
SA10578

Solution:
Apply updated packages.
